About the Position

We are seeking an experienced Senior Superintendent to join our team and take leadership in managing and overseeing large-scale commercial construction projects. This position offers an exciting opportunity to work on significant, high-value projects. The Senior Superintendent will be responsible for ensuring that construction projects are completed safely, on time, and to the highest quality standards, while managing the day-to-day operations on the job site.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ead and supervise all field operations, including managing subcontractors, construction crews, and project schedules.
  • Ensure that all safety standards and regulations are met or exceeded on job sites.
  • Coordinate daily activities on site to ensure the project progresses smoothly, and issues are addressed promptly.
  • Collaborate with project managers, engineers, and architects to ensure effective communication and project delivery.
  • Monitor and maintain quality control, ensuring that work is completed per design specifications and building codes.
  • Manage project budgets, identify cost-saving opportunities, and address any budget discrepancies in collaboration with the project team.

Requirements

  • Experience : At least 10 years of experience in construction, with a strong background in commercial projects, ideally ranging from $50M to $100M.
  • Leadership : Proven experience managing construction teams, subcontractors, and other on-site personnel.
  • Industry Knowledge : Deep understanding of construction methods, safety practices, and building codes.
  • Skills : Strong problem-solving, communication, and organizational skills. Proficiency in construction management software and scheduling tools.
  • Education : Bachelor’s degree in Construction Management, Civil Engineering, or related field, or equivalent work experience.
  • Local Knowledge : Familiarity with local Charleston building codes and regulations is highly desirable.
